The label itself

What the Supplement Facts panel says

Serving size 0.2 mL (0.04 tsp; 4 drops) · 296 servings per container · 2 FL OZ (59 ML)

Vitamin D (as Cholecalciferol)125 mcg
Vitamin K2 (from Menaquinone) (MK-7)100 mcg

Printed on the package: Gluten Free · Vegetarian · cGMP Facility · Third Party Tested · Recyclable · Made in the USA · ISO 14001 Certified

We read 2 lines from the package photograph. It is our transcript of the label, not the manufacturer’s panel, and it may be incomplete.

Needs explanationAny trouble in public records?

FDA recall appears in this brand's history

An exact-product recall is a direct signal. A different product from the same firm is company context, not a strike against this item.

Evidence and sources

This recall is not about the product on this page. Mineralife LLC recalled a different product on October 15, 2018. FDA has since closed that case. The recalled item was “Trace Minerals Dietary Supplement , 16.2 fl oz (480 mL) bottles, Packaged in dark blue plastic bottles, For…”
